Disaster restoration services involve the assessment, cleanup, and repair of properties affected by various types of damage, such as water intrusion, fire, storms, or mold growth. These services are essential for mitigating further deterioration and restoring properties to a safe and functional condition. Restoration professionals utilize specialized equipment and techniques to remove debris, dry out affected areas, and address structural issues, ensuring that the property is stabilized and prepared for any necessary repairs.
These services help address a range of problems caused by unforeseen events. Water damage from leaks or flooding can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and structural weakening if not promptly managed. Fire incidents can leave behind smoke and soot residue, causing health hazards and property degradation. Storms may result in roof damage, broken windows, or water infiltration, which can compromise the integrity of a building. Restoration services aim to eliminate these hazards, prevent secondary issues, and restore the property’s safety and appearance.

Restoration Costs - Typical expenses for disaster restoration services can range from $2,000 to $15,000 depending on the extent of damage. For example, minor water damage repairs may cost around $2,500, while extensive fire damage restoration could exceed $10,000. Costs vary based on the size and severity of the incident.
Water Damage Restoration - The cost for water damage repair generally falls between $3,000 and $8,000. Smaller areas might be restored for approximately $3,500, whereas larger or more severe cases can reach $8,000 or more. Factors influencing costs include the affected area and the need for structural drying.
Fire Damage Restoration - Fire damage restoration services typically range from $4,000 to $20,000. Minor smoke and soot cleanup may cost around $4,500, while extensive rebuilding after a major fire can surpass $15,000. The scope of work and materials required impact overall expenses.
Mold Remediation Costs - Mold removal services generally cost between $1,500 and $6,000. Small mold issues might be addressed for approximately $1,800, whereas larger infestations requiring extensive cleanup can reach $6,000 or more. Cost depends on the size of the affected area and contamination level.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
